在數字貨幣和區塊鏈技術(shù)日益發(fā)展的今天,各種與數字資產(chǎn)相關(guān)的服務(wù)層出不窮。其中,小狐錢(qián)包作為一款熱門(mén)的數...
在區塊鏈技術(shù)不斷發(fā)展的今天,MetaMask 作為一種流行的以太坊錢(qián)包之一,已經(jīng)成為了廣大用戶(hù)進(jìn)行數字資產(chǎn)管理、參與去中心化金融(DeFi)和非同質(zhì)化代幣(NFT)交易的重要工具。然而,使用 MetaMask 錢(qián)包時(shí),常常會(huì )涉及到授權這一過(guò)程。本文將詳細介紹 MetaMask 錢(qián)包的授權功能,以及如何安全有效地進(jìn)行授權,從而增強用戶(hù)的使用體驗和資產(chǎn)安全性。
首先,我們需要理解 MetaMask 錢(qián)包的基本功能。作為一款瀏覽器擴展和移動(dòng)應用,MetaMask 使得用戶(hù)能夠方便地與以太坊區塊鏈互動(dòng)。用戶(hù)通過(guò) MetaMask 可以管理以太坊及其代幣,訪(fǎng)問(wèn)去中心化應用(DApps),簽署交易,在 NFT 市場(chǎng)中進(jìn)行創(chuàng )作和交易等。
在使用 MetaMask 過(guò)程中,授權是一個(gè)必不可少的環(huán)節。所謂授權,指的是用戶(hù)允許某個(gè) DApp 或服務(wù)訪(fǎng)問(wèn)其資金、簽名交易或進(jìn)行其他操作。授權通常涉及到對某個(gè)合約的訪(fǎng)問(wèn)權限,以便用戶(hù)能夠安全地使用相應的功能。
授權不等同于直接轉賬。用戶(hù)在授權時(shí),僅僅是在授權某個(gè)合約或者 DApp 使用一定權限,實(shí)際的資金轉移還需要用戶(hù)的進(jìn)一步確認和操作。因此,用戶(hù)在執行授權動(dòng)作之前,必須確保所使用的 DApp 是可信的。
授權過(guò)程相對簡(jiǎn)單,但需要謹慎進(jìn)行。以下是授權的一般步驟:
下載和安裝 MetaMask:用戶(hù)可以從官方網(wǎng)頁(yè)(https://metamask.io)下載并安裝 MetaMask 插件或者手機應用。確保不從非官方渠道下載,以避免安全隱患。
創(chuàng )建或導入錢(qián)包:用戶(hù)可以選擇創(chuàng )建一個(gè)新錢(qián)包,并妥善記住助記詞,或導入已有的錢(qián)包。
連接 DApp:用戶(hù)訪(fǎng)問(wèn)需要使用 MetaMask 的 DApp,通常這些 DApp 會(huì )提示用戶(hù)連接錢(qián)包。點(diǎn)擊連接按鈕后,MetaMask 會(huì )彈出窗口,詢(xún)問(wèn)用戶(hù)是否授權該 DApp 訪(fǎng)問(wèn)錢(qián)包。
驗證請求:用戶(hù)需仔細查看授權請求的詳細信息,包括 DApp 的名稱(chēng)和請求的權限。在確保無(wú)誤后,點(diǎn)擊“確認”進(jìn)行授權。
此時(shí),用戶(hù)已經(jīng)成功完成授權,可以在該 DApp 中進(jìn)行相應的操作,比如進(jìn)行交易、轉換資產(chǎn)等。
盡管 MetaMask 提供了方便的授權機制,但如果用戶(hù)不加以注意,仍然可能面臨安全風(fēng)險。以下是一些常見(jiàn)的安全隱患:
惡意 DApp:一些不良開(kāi)發(fā)者可能會(huì )創(chuàng )建假冒的 DApp 以獲取用戶(hù)的授權,造成資金損失。因此,用戶(hù)在連接任何 DApp 前要確認其真實(shí)身份,并查閱相關(guān)反饋或評價(jià)。
過(guò)度授權:用戶(hù)在授權時(shí),可能不小心給予了 DApp 過(guò)廣的權限,比如無(wú)限制的資金訪(fǎng)問(wèn)權限。最好在授予權限時(shí)采取謹慎態(tài)度,限制授權的范圍和金額。
賬戶(hù)被盜:如果用戶(hù)的 MetaMask 錢(qián)包泄露或受到攻擊,未經(jīng)授權的資金轉移將不可避免。在此情況下,及時(shí)更改助記詞和引入硬件錢(qián)包等安全措施可以幫助減輕損失。
因此,用戶(hù)在授權之前,務(wù)必要進(jìn)行仔細的調查和風(fēng)險評估。
如果用戶(hù)發(fā)現自己已經(jīng)授權了某個(gè)不再信任的 DApp,或者希望撤銷(xiāo)聊天某個(gè)合約的訪(fǎng)問(wèn)權限,則需要進(jìn)行撤銷(xiāo)操作。可以通過(guò)以下幾種方式實(shí)現:
使用區塊鏈瀏覽器:用戶(hù)可以通過(guò)以太坊區塊鏈瀏覽器(如 Etherscan)找到對應的合約地址,查看其相關(guān)的授權信息,并手動(dòng)撤銷(xiāo)相應的授權。
使用合約管理工具:一些合約管理工具(如 Revoke.cash)允許用戶(hù)掃描其授權的合約,并方便地進(jìn)行撤銷(xiāo)操作。然而,使用此類(lèi)工具時(shí),務(wù)必確認其來(lái)源和安全性。
重新授權:在某些情況下,用戶(hù)可以選擇對不再信任的 DApp 撤銷(xiāo)授權,同時(shí)為自己的錢(qián)包重設新權限。重新授權也可以幫助減少潛在風(fēng)險。
為了增強 MetaMask 錢(qián)包的安全性,用戶(hù)在進(jìn)行授權時(shí)應遵循一些最佳實(shí)踐:
始終使用官方渠道:下載和安裝 MetaMask 時(shí),請始終訪(fǎng)問(wèn)官方網(wǎng)站,避免非正式渠道的下載和安裝。
審查 DApp 的信譽(yù):在連接 DApp 前,應檢查其聲譽(yù)和用戶(hù)反饋。這可以通過(guò)社區論壇或社交媒體進(jìn)行。
授權權限最小化:盡量限制 DApp 的訪(fǎng)問(wèn)權限,明確所需的最低權限。避免給予 DApp 不必要的全面訪(fǎng)問(wèn)權限。
定期檢查授權:定期檢查已授權的 DApp,并撤銷(xiāo)不再需要的授權,確保錢(qián)包安全。
MetaMask 錢(qián)包的授權機制為用戶(hù)提供了便利的同時(shí),也帶來(lái)了安全風(fēng)險。用戶(hù)必須了解授權的含義、過(guò)程和相關(guān)風(fēng)險,從而做出明智的決策。通過(guò)謹慎操作和遵循最佳實(shí)踐,用戶(hù)可以在享受去中心化金融帶來(lái)的便利的同時(shí),保護好自己的數字資產(chǎn)安全。從而在區塊鏈時(shí)代中,充分體驗到資產(chǎn)管理的安全與便捷。
MetaMask 錢(qián)包的技術(shù)原理主要基于以太坊區塊鏈。MetaMask 作為一個(gè)基于瀏覽器的數字錢(qián)包,允許用戶(hù)生成和管理以太坊賬戶(hù)。在 MetaMask 的背后,用戶(hù)的錢(qián)包是通過(guò)一個(gè)密鑰對(公鑰和私鑰)來(lái)保護的。公鑰用于生成以太坊賬戶(hù)地址,而私鑰則是一串隨機生成的字符,用于證明用戶(hù)對這些資產(chǎn)的控制權。
MetaMask 會(huì )將用戶(hù)的錢(qián)包信息加密存儲在用戶(hù)的瀏覽器中,確保只有用戶(hù)本人可以訪(fǎng)問(wèn)。同時(shí),MetaMask 提供了一種用戶(hù)友好的界面,使得用戶(hù)可以輕松地連接 DApp 和其他區塊鏈服務(wù)。
用戶(hù)在 MetaMask 中進(jìn)行交易或者授權,其實(shí)就是在與以太坊網(wǎng)絡(luò )進(jìn)行交互,MetaMask 會(huì )幫助用戶(hù)構造相應的交易數據,并通過(guò)其私鑰進(jìn)行簽名,當交易被確認后,用戶(hù)的錢(qián)包中的以太坊或代幣就會(huì )發(fā)生變動(dòng)。
保障用戶(hù)資金安全是 MetaMask 最重要的職責之一。MetaMask 采取了多種安全機制來(lái)保護用戶(hù)的賬戶(hù)和資產(chǎn):
私鑰管理:用戶(hù)的私鑰從未被 MetaMask 服務(wù)器存儲,所有加密與解密操作都在客戶(hù)端本地完成。建議用戶(hù)使用強大的助記詞和密碼組合。
加密存儲:用戶(hù)的錢(qián)包是以加密形式存儲的,只有在用戶(hù)輸入密碼后才能解密并訪(fǎng)問(wèn)。
交易確認:每次進(jìn)行交易時(shí),都會(huì )要求用戶(hù)進(jìn)行確認,這樣可以確保用戶(hù)明確自己的操作意圖,避免誤操作。
網(wǎng)絡(luò )安全:MetaMask 通過(guò)使用最新的網(wǎng)絡(luò )技術(shù)與標準,盡量防范各種網(wǎng)絡(luò )攻擊風(fēng)險,例如通過(guò)使用非對稱(chēng)加密技術(shù)來(lái)保護通信安全。
社區反饋機制:MetaMask 擁有廣大的用戶(hù)基礎和活躍的社區,若有用戶(hù)發(fā)現安全漏洞或可疑行為,可以及時(shí)向開(kāi)發(fā)團隊反饋,進(jìn)行修復和改進(jìn)。
使用 MetaMask 進(jìn)行交易的流程相對簡(jiǎn)單,具體步驟如下:
安裝和設置 MetaMask:用戶(hù)需要下載并安裝 MetaMask 瀏覽器擴展,然后創(chuàng )建一個(gè)新的以太坊賬戶(hù)或導入已存在的賬戶(hù),并備份助記詞。
確保錢(qián)包中有以太坊:用戶(hù)需要將以太坊轉入自己創(chuàng )建的 MetaMask 錢(qián)包,可以通過(guò)交易所購買(mǎi)或向朋友轉賬。
訪(fǎng)問(wèn)交易 DApp:用戶(hù)打開(kāi)需要進(jìn)行交易的 DApp,通常 DApp 會(huì )提供“連接錢(qián)包”的選項。
授權連接:用戶(hù)點(diǎn)擊連接錢(qián)包的按鈕,MetaMask 會(huì )彈出窗口,詢(xún)問(wèn)用戶(hù)是否授權該 DApp 訪(fǎng)問(wèn)其錢(qián)包。確認后即完成連接。
創(chuàng )建交易:用戶(hù)選擇進(jìn)行的交易操作,輸入相關(guān)的參數和數量。
確認交易信息:在提交交易之前,用戶(hù)需再次確認交易信息,檢查 gas 費用和接收地址。
簽名交易:用戶(hù)確認信息后,需要通過(guò) MetaMask 對交易進(jìn)行簽名,MetaMask 會(huì )發(fā)送簽名后的交易請求到以太坊網(wǎng)絡(luò )。
等待確認:交易被礦工打包并確認后,用戶(hù)錢(qián)包中的資產(chǎn)變動(dòng)就會(huì )生成,用戶(hù)可以查看交易記錄。
以上就是使用 MetaMask 進(jìn)行交易的基本流程,用戶(hù)在操作過(guò)程中注意安全措施,可以有效保護資產(chǎn)。
選擇安全的 DApp 是使用 MetaMask 的重要一環(huán),以下幾點(diǎn)可以幫助用戶(hù)評估 DApp 的安全性:
查看官方網(wǎng)站:首先,確保訪(fǎng)問(wèn) DApp 的官方網(wǎng)站,通過(guò)官方渠道獲取信息,而不是隨便通過(guò)搜索引擎查找,以免誤入釣魚(yú)網(wǎng)站。
社區口碑:在相關(guān)社交媒體、論壇(如 Reddit 和 Twitter)上搜索有關(guān)該 DApp 的評價(jià),看看其他用戶(hù)的體驗和反饋。如果出現頻繁的負面評價(jià),最好小心謹慎。
審計報告:許多安全的 DApp 會(huì )有專(zhuān)業(yè)的第三方安全審計報告,顯示其代碼的安全性和漏洞修復情況,用戶(hù)應盡量選擇經(jīng)過(guò)審計的 DApp。
監測交互記錄:用戶(hù)在使用 DApp 過(guò)程中,可以關(guān)注與自己資產(chǎn)的交互記錄,若出現異常交易,則應立即變更授權權限或撤銷(xiāo)連接。
保持警惕:在對任何 DApp 進(jìn)行授權和交易時(shí),要時(shí)刻保持警惕,任何時(shí)候都不要輸入助記詞或私鑰,真正的 DApp 不會(huì )要求此類(lèi)信息。
通過(guò)以上方法,可以有效評估 DApp 的安全性,減少資產(chǎn)被攻擊和盜竊的風(fēng)險。
綜上所述,通過(guò)對 MetaMask 錢(qián)包授權的詳細介紹和相關(guān)問(wèn)題的解答,用戶(hù)不僅可以順利地使用 MetaMask 進(jìn)行各種操作,同時(shí)也能夠增強對自身資產(chǎn)的安全管理。希望這些信息能夠幫助用戶(hù)在區塊鏈世界中順暢前行。
TokenPocket是全球最大的數字貨幣錢(qián)包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在內的所有主流公鏈及Layer 2,已為全球近千萬(wàn)用戶(hù)提供可信賴(lài)的數字貨幣資產(chǎn)管理服務(wù),也是當前DeFi用戶(hù)必備的工具錢(qián)包。